Observer Based Predictive Controller for Hall-Heroult Process

Résumé

Hall-Héroult process is a complex electrolysis procedure to produce aluminum at industrial scale. Due to the extreme operational conditions, it is difficult to continuously measure and precisely control this process. This results into limitations in the efficiency. This paper proposes a linear predictive control strategy for process states regulation. The solution relies on the use of an estimator and considers the process constraints to enhance productivity. Based on real industrial conditions, a tuning procedure is discussed and the proposed control approach is illustrated and tested in different simulation scenarios.
